What Are Sign Up Bonuses?
Sign up bonuses, also known as welcome bonuses, are promotional offers provided by online casinos to attract new players. These offers are designed to give newcomers a head start on their gambling journey, often through a combination of bonus funds, free spins, or other perks. Typically, these bonuses are available upon creating an account and making an initial deposit. They are a crucial part of a casino’s marketing strategy, helping to differentiate one platform from another in a highly competitive market.
Types of Sign Up Bonuses
Deposit Match Bonuses
- This is the most common type of sign up bonus. The casino matches a percentage of your first deposit—often 100%, sometimes up to a specific amount. For example, if the bonus is 100% up to $200, and you deposit $200, you’ll receive an additional $200 in bonus funds.
- These bonuses provide a substantial boost but are subject to wagering requirements before withdrawal.
Free Spins Offers
- Many casinos include free spins as part of their welcome package, often tied to specific slot games.
- For instance, you might receive 50 free spins on a popular slot upon signing up and making a qualifying deposit.
- Winnings from free spins usually have their own wagering restrictions, which players should review carefully.
No Deposit Bonuses
- Less common but highly attractive, no deposit bonuses give you a small amount of bonus money or free spins just for registering an account.
- This allows you to try the platform risk-free before committing your own funds.
- However, these bonuses tend to be smaller and often come with strict wagering terms.
How Do Sign Up Bonuses Work?
Once you create an account and fulfill the necessary deposit or registration requirements, the casino credits your account with the bonus funds or free spins. It’s important to note that these bonuses are not immediately withdrawable. Instead, you must meet specific wagering requirements, which involve betting a certain amount of money within a given timeframe. Typically, the process involves:
- Registering a new account and providing accurate details.
- Making an initial deposit (if applicable) to trigger the match bonus or claiming free spins.
- Playing eligible games, which often include slots, table games, or live dealer options.
- Meeting the wagering conditions before requesting a withdrawal of winnings derived from the bonus.
Always read the terms and conditions attached to these bonuses to understand caps, game restrictions, and time limits, ensuring a smooth experience.

Things to Consider Before Claiming a Bonus
While sign up bonuses are attractive, they come with certain conditions that can affect your overall experience:
Wagering Requirements
Most bonuses require players to wager the bonus amount multiple times before they can withdraw any winnings. For example, a 30x wagering requirement means you must bet 30 times the bonus amount. Low wagering requirements are generally more favorable.
Game Restrictions
Some bonuses apply only to specific games or categories. Slots are usually the most favored for wagering, but table games like roulette or blackjack may be excluded or count less toward wagering totals.
Time Limits
Bonuses often have expiration periods; if you don’t meet the wagering requirements within the stipulated time, the bonus may expire, and any winnings associated with it could be forfeited.
Maximum Cashout Limits
Many bonuses impose a cap on the amount you can withdraw from winnings derived from bonus funds. Recognizing these limits helps set realistic expectations.
